Quote:

Originally Posted by 69Cobra (Post 278273)
Am I reading the guide correctly that the 5.0 GT is a D car rated at 325?

That would be a 2012 Cobra Jet body with a Coyote 5.0 based "crate" engine.

The last time a Mustang GT was legal in Stock was the 2008 model and NHRA rated that 4.6 3V @ 300 hp.

The 2010 CJ with the 4.6 3V is rated @ ONLY 232 hp..........what a joke. It should be more like 322 hp. Maybe someone at NHRA has the numbers inverted ?
